DeviationTX / deviation

Custom firmware for RC Transmitters
http://www.deviationtx.com
GNU General Public License v3.0
247 stars 153 forks source link

Add protocol radiolink #1034

Closed hexfet closed 1 year ago

hexfet commented 1 year ago

My first car uses Dumbo RC equipment. This protocol is supported in the DIY-Multiprotocol-TX-Module project. This code is a port of the radiolink implementation from that project.

The Radiolink protocol supports Radiolink and Dumbo receivers. |cc2500-note| |mod-install-link|

The protocol supports up to 8 channels. Default channel order is AETR. Telemetry is supported using the Frsky telemetry layout. The following values are supported: VOLT1, VOLT2, RSSI, LRSSI, and LQI. Telemetry is not supported by the Dumbo protocol.

The following protocol options are available.

Format: Receiver selection for Air, Surface, or Dumbo.

Freq-Fine: Frequency offset adjustment. Range -127 to 127. Adjusts for variances betweeen CC2500 modules. Usually offset of 0 or -41 is required, but full range should be tested if there are problems with binding or range. Default 0.